405 /* Hauppauge card? get values from tveeprom */
406 void ivtv_read_eeprom(struct ivtv *itv, struct tveeprom *tv)
407 {
408 	u8 eedata[256];
409 
410 	itv->i2c_client.addr = 0xA0 >> 1;
411 	tveeprom_read(&itv->i2c_client, eedata, sizeof(eedata));
412 	tveeprom_hauppauge_analog(&itv->i2c_client, tv, eedata);
413 }
414 
415 static void ivtv_process_eeprom(struct ivtv *itv)
416 {
417 	struct tveeprom tv;
418 	int pci_slot = PCI_SLOT(itv->pdev->devfn);
419 
420 	ivtv_read_eeprom(itv, &tv);
421 
422 	/* Many thanks to Steven Toth from Hauppauge for providing the
423 	   model numbers */
424 	switch (tv.model) {
425 		/* In a few cases the PCI subsystem IDs do not correctly
426 		   identify the card. A better method is to check the
427 		   model number from the eeprom instead. */
428 		case 30012 ... 30039:  /* Low profile PVR250 */
429 		case 32000 ... 32999:
430 		case 48000 ... 48099:  /* 48??? range are PVR250s with a cx23415 */
431 		case 48400 ... 48599:
432 			itv->card = ivtv_get_card(IVTV_CARD_PVR_250);
433 			break;
434 		case 48100 ... 48399:
435 		case 48600 ... 48999:
436 			itv->card = ivtv_get_card(IVTV_CARD_PVR_350);
437 			break;
438 		case 23000 ... 23999:  /* PVR500 */
439 		case 25000 ... 25999:  /* Low profile PVR150 */
440 		case 26000 ... 26999:  /* Regular PVR150 */
441 			itv->card = ivtv_get_card(IVTV_CARD_PVR_150);
442 			break;
443 		case 0:
444 			IVTV_ERR("Invalid EEPROM\n");
445 			return;
446 		default:
447 			IVTV_ERR("Unknown model %d, defaulting to PVR-150\n", tv.model);
448 			itv->card = ivtv_get_card(IVTV_CARD_PVR_150);
449 			break;
450 	}
451 
452 	switch (tv.model) {
453 		/* Old style PVR350 (with an saa7114) uses this input for
454 		   the tuner. */
455 		case 48254:
456 			itv->card = ivtv_get_card(IVTV_CARD_PVR_350_V1);
457 			break;
458 		default:
459 			break;
460 	}
461 
462 	itv->v4l2_cap = itv->card->v4l2_capabilities;
463 	itv->card_name = itv->card->name;
464 	itv->card_i2c = itv->card->i2c;
465 
466 	/* If this is a PVR500 then it should be possible to detect whether it is the
467 	   first or second unit by looking at the subsystem device ID: is bit 4 is
468 	   set, then it is the second unit (according to info from Hauppauge).
469 
470 	   However, while this works for most cards, I have seen a few PVR500 cards
471 	   where both units have the same subsystem ID.
472 
473 	   So instead I look at the reported 'PCI slot' (which is the slot on the PVR500
474 	   PCI bridge) and if it is 8, then it is assumed to be the first unit, otherwise
475 	   it is the second unit. It is possible that it is a different slot when ivtv is
476 	   used in Xen, in that case I ignore this card here. The worst that can happen
477 	   is that the card presents itself with a non-working radio device.
478 
479 	   This detection is needed since the eeprom reports incorrectly that a radio is
480 	   present on the second unit. */
481 	if (tv.model / 1000 == 23) {
482 		static const struct ivtv_card_tuner_i2c ivtv_i2c_radio = {
483 			.radio = { 0x60, I2C_CLIENT_END },
484 			.demod = { 0x43, I2C_CLIENT_END },
485 			.tv = { 0x61, I2C_CLIENT_END },
486 		};
487 
488 		itv->card_name = "WinTV PVR 500";
489 		itv->card_i2c = &ivtv_i2c_radio;
490 		if (pci_slot == 8 || pci_slot == 9) {
491 			int is_first = (pci_slot & 1) == 0;
492 
493 			itv->card_name = is_first ? "WinTV PVR 500 (unit #1)" :
494 						    "WinTV PVR 500 (unit #2)";
495 			if (!is_first) {
496 				IVTV_INFO("Correcting tveeprom data: no radio present on second unit\n");
497 				tv.has_radio = 0;
498 			}
499 		}
500 	}
501 	IVTV_INFO("Autodetected %s\n", itv->card_name);
502 
503 	switch (tv.tuner_hauppauge_model) {
504 		case 85:
505 		case 99:
506 		case 112:
507 			itv->pvr150_workaround = 1;
508 			break;
509 		default:
510 			break;
511 	}
512 	if (tv.tuner_type == TUNER_ABSENT)
513 		IVTV_ERR("tveeprom cannot autodetect tuner!\n");
514 
515 	if (itv->options.tuner == -1)
516 		itv->options.tuner = tv.tuner_type;
517 	if (itv->options.radio == -1)
518 		itv->options.radio = (tv.has_radio != 0);
519 	/* only enable newi2c if an IR blaster is present */
520 	if (itv->options.newi2c == -1 && tv.has_ir) {
521 		itv->options.newi2c = (tv.has_ir & 4) ? 1 : 0;
522 		if (itv->options.newi2c) {
523 		    IVTV_INFO("Reopen i2c bus for IR-blaster support\n");
524 		    exit_ivtv_i2c(itv);
525 		    init_ivtv_i2c(itv);
526 		}
527 	}
528 
529 	if (itv->std != 0)
530 		/* user specified tuner standard */
531 		return;
532 
533 	/* autodetect tuner standard */
534 	if (tv.tuner_formats & V4L2_STD_PAL) {
535 		IVTV_DEBUG_INFO("PAL tuner detected\n");
536 		itv->std |= V4L2_STD_PAL_BG | V4L2_STD_PAL_H;
537 	} else if (tv.tuner_formats & V4L2_STD_NTSC) {
538 		IVTV_DEBUG_INFO("NTSC tuner detected\n");
539 		itv->std |= V4L2_STD_NTSC_M;
540 	} else if (tv.tuner_formats & V4L2_STD_SECAM) {
541 		IVTV_DEBUG_INFO("SECAM tuner detected\n");
542 		itv->std |= V4L2_STD_SECAM_L;
543 	} else {
544 		IVTV_INFO("No tuner detected, default to NTSC-M\n");
545 		itv->std |= V4L2_STD_NTSC_M;
546 	}
547 }

836 static int ivtv_setup_pci(struct ivtv *itv, struct pci_dev *pdev,
837 			  const struct pci_device_id *pci_id)
838 {
839 	u16 cmd;
840 	unsigned char pci_latency;
841 
842 	IVTV_DEBUG_INFO("Enabling pci device\n");
843 
844 	if (pci_enable_device(pdev)) {
845 		IVTV_ERR("Can't enable device!\n");
846 		return -EIO;
847 	}
848 	if (pci_set_dma_mask(pdev, DMA_BIT_MASK(32))) {
849 		IVTV_ERR("No suitable DMA available.\n");
850 		return -EIO;
851 	}
852 	if (!request_mem_region(itv->base_addr, IVTV_ENCODER_SIZE, "ivtv encoder")) {
853 		IVTV_ERR("Cannot request encoder memory region.\n");
854 		return -EIO;
855 	}
856 
857 	if (!request_mem_region(itv->base_addr + IVTV_REG_OFFSET,
858 				IVTV_REG_SIZE, "ivtv registers")) {
859 		IVTV_ERR("Cannot request register memory region.\n");
860 		release_mem_region(itv->base_addr, IVTV_ENCODER_SIZE);
861 		return -EIO;
862 	}
863 
864 	if (itv->has_cx23415 &&
865 	    !request_mem_region(itv->base_addr + IVTV_DECODER_OFFSET,
866 				IVTV_DECODER_SIZE, "ivtv decoder")) {
867 		IVTV_ERR("Cannot request decoder memory region.\n");
868 		release_mem_region(itv->base_addr, IVTV_ENCODER_SIZE);
869 		release_mem_region(itv->base_addr + IVTV_REG_OFFSET, IVTV_REG_SIZE);
870 		return -EIO;
871 	}
872 
873 	/* Check for bus mastering */
874 	pci_read_config_word(pdev, PCI_COMMAND, &cmd);
875 	if (!(cmd & PCI_COMMAND_MASTER)) {
876 		IVTV_DEBUG_INFO("Attempting to enable Bus Mastering\n");
877 		pci_set_master(pdev);
878 		pci_read_config_word(pdev, PCI_COMMAND, &cmd);
879 		if (!(cmd & PCI_COMMAND_MASTER)) {
880 			IVTV_ERR("Bus Mastering is not enabled\n");
881 			return -ENXIO;
882 		}
883 	}
884 	IVTV_DEBUG_INFO("Bus Mastering Enabled.\n");
885 
886 	pci_read_config_byte(pdev, PCI_LATENCY_TIMER, &pci_latency);
887 
888 	if (pci_latency < 64 && ivtv_pci_latency) {
889 		IVTV_INFO("Unreasonably low latency timer, "
890 			       "setting to 64 (was %d)\n", pci_latency);
891 		pci_write_config_byte(pdev, PCI_LATENCY_TIMER, 64);
892 		pci_read_config_byte(pdev, PCI_LATENCY_TIMER, &pci_latency);
893 	}
894 	/* This config space value relates to DMA latencies. The
895 	   default value 0x8080 is too low however and will lead
896 	   to DMA errors. 0xffff is the max value which solves
897 	   these problems. */
898 	pci_write_config_dword(pdev, 0x40, 0xffff);
899 
900 	IVTV_DEBUG_INFO("%d (rev %d) at %02x:%02x.%x, "
901 		   "irq: %d, latency: %d, memory: 0x%llx\n",
902 		   pdev->device, pdev->revision, pdev->bus->number,
903 		   PCI_SLOT(pdev->devfn), PCI_FUNC(pdev->devfn),
904 		   pdev->irq, pci_latency, (u64)itv->base_addr);
905 
906 	return 0;
907 }

1004 static int ivtv_probe(struct pci_dev *pdev, const struct pci_device_id *pci_id)
1005 {
1006 	int retval = 0;
1007 	int vbi_buf_size;
1008 	struct ivtv *itv;
1009 
1010 	itv = kzalloc(sizeof(struct ivtv), GFP_ATOMIC);
1011 	if (itv == NULL)
1012 		return -ENOMEM;
1013 	itv->pdev = pdev;
1014 	itv->instance = v4l2_device_set_name(&itv->v4l2_dev, "ivtv",
1015 						&ivtv_instance);
1016 
1017 	retval = v4l2_device_register(&pdev->dev, &itv->v4l2_dev);
1018 	if (retval) {
1019 		kfree(itv);
1020 		return retval;
1021 	}
1022 	IVTV_INFO("Initializing card %d\n", itv->instance);
1023 
1024 	ivtv_process_options(itv);
1025 	if (itv->options.cardtype == -1) {
1026 		retval = -ENODEV;
1027 		goto err;
1028 	}
1029 	if (ivtv_init_struct1(itv)) {
1030 		retval = -ENOMEM;
1031 		goto err;
1032 	}
1033 	retval = cx2341x_handler_init(&itv->cxhdl, 50);
1034 	if (retval)
1035 		goto err;
1036 	itv->v4l2_dev.ctrl_handler = &itv->cxhdl.hdl;
1037 	itv->cxhdl.ops = &ivtv_cxhdl_ops;
1038 	itv->cxhdl.priv = itv;
1039 	itv->cxhdl.func = ivtv_api_func;
1040 
1041 	IVTV_DEBUG_INFO("base addr: 0x%llx\n", (u64)itv->base_addr);
1042 
1043 	/* PCI Device Setup */
1044 	retval = ivtv_setup_pci(itv, pdev, pci_id);
1045 	if (retval == -EIO)
1046 		goto free_worker;
1047 	if (retval == -ENXIO)
1048 		goto free_mem;
1049 
1050 	/* map io memory */
1051 	IVTV_DEBUG_INFO("attempting ioremap at 0x%llx len 0x%08x\n",
1052 		   (u64)itv->base_addr + IVTV_ENCODER_OFFSET, IVTV_ENCODER_SIZE);
1053 	itv->enc_mem = ioremap_nocache(itv->base_addr + IVTV_ENCODER_OFFSET,
1054 				       IVTV_ENCODER_SIZE);
1055 	if (!itv->enc_mem) {
1056 		IVTV_ERR("ioremap failed. Can't get a window into CX23415/6 "
1057 			 "encoder memory\n");
1058 		IVTV_ERR("Each capture card with a CX23415/6 needs 8 MB of "
1059 			 "vmalloc address space for this window\n");
1060 		IVTV_ERR("Check the output of 'grep Vmalloc /proc/meminfo'\n");
1061 		IVTV_ERR("Use the vmalloc= kernel command line option to set "
1062 			 "VmallocTotal to a larger value\n");
1063 		retval = -ENOMEM;
1064 		goto free_mem;
1065 	}
1066 
1067 	if (itv->has_cx23415) {
1068 		IVTV_DEBUG_INFO("attempting ioremap at 0x%llx len 0x%08x\n",
1069 				(u64)itv->base_addr + IVTV_DECODER_OFFSET, IVTV_DECODER_SIZE);
1070 		itv->dec_mem = ioremap_nocache(itv->base_addr + IVTV_DECODER_OFFSET,
1071 				IVTV_DECODER_SIZE);
1072 		if (!itv->dec_mem) {
1073 			IVTV_ERR("ioremap failed. Can't get a window into "
1074 				 "CX23415 decoder memory\n");
1075 			IVTV_ERR("Each capture card with a CX23415 needs 8 MB "
1076 				 "of vmalloc address space for this window\n");
1077 			IVTV_ERR("Check the output of 'grep Vmalloc "
1078 				 "/proc/meminfo'\n");
1079 			IVTV_ERR("Use the vmalloc= kernel command line option "
1080 				 "to set VmallocTotal to a larger value\n");
1081 			retval = -ENOMEM;
1082 			goto free_mem;
1083 		}
1084 	}
1085 	else {
1086 		itv->dec_mem = itv->enc_mem;
1087 	}
1088 
1089 	/* map registers memory */
1090 	IVTV_DEBUG_INFO("attempting ioremap at 0x%llx len 0x%08x\n",
1091 		   (u64)itv->base_addr + IVTV_REG_OFFSET, IVTV_REG_SIZE);
1092 	itv->reg_mem =
1093 	    ioremap_nocache(itv->base_addr + IVTV_REG_OFFSET, IVTV_REG_SIZE);
1094 	if (!itv->reg_mem) {
1095 		IVTV_ERR("ioremap failed. Can't get a window into CX23415/6 "
1096 			 "register space\n");
1097 		IVTV_ERR("Each capture card with a CX23415/6 needs 64 kB of "
1098 			 "vmalloc address space for this window\n");
1099 		IVTV_ERR("Check the output of 'grep Vmalloc /proc/meminfo'\n");
1100 		IVTV_ERR("Use the vmalloc= kernel command line option to set "
1101 			 "VmallocTotal to a larger value\n");
1102 		retval = -ENOMEM;
1103 		goto free_io;
1104 	}
1105 
1106 	retval = ivtv_gpio_init(itv);
1107 	if (retval)
1108 		goto free_io;
1109 
1110 	/* active i2c  */
1111 	IVTV_DEBUG_INFO("activating i2c...\n");
1112 	if (init_ivtv_i2c(itv)) {
1113 		IVTV_ERR("Could not initialize i2c\n");
1114 		goto free_io;
1115 	}
1116 
1117 	if (itv->card->hw_all & IVTV_HW_TVEEPROM) {
1118 		/* Based on the model number the cardtype may be changed.
1119 		   The PCI IDs are not always reliable. */
1120 		ivtv_process_eeprom(itv);
1121 	}
1122 	if (itv->card->comment)
1123 		IVTV_INFO("%s", itv->card->comment);
1124 	if (itv->card->v4l2_capabilities == 0) {
1125 		/* card was detected but is not supported */
1126 		retval = -ENODEV;
1127 		goto free_i2c;
1128 	}
1129 
1130 	if (itv->std == 0) {
1131 		itv->std = V4L2_STD_NTSC_M;
1132 	}
1133 
1134 	if (itv->options.tuner == -1) {
1135 		int i;
1136 
1137 		for (i = 0; i < IVTV_CARD_MAX_TUNERS; i++) {
1138 			if ((itv->std & itv->card->tuners[i].std) == 0)
1139 				continue;
1140 			itv->options.tuner = itv->card->tuners[i].tuner;
1141 			break;
1142 		}
1143 	}
1144 	/* if no tuner was found, then pick the first tuner in the card list */
1145 	if (itv->options.tuner == -1 && itv->card->tuners[0].std) {
1146 		itv->std = itv->card->tuners[0].std;
1147 		if (itv->std & V4L2_STD_PAL)
1148 			itv->std = V4L2_STD_PAL_BG | V4L2_STD_PAL_H;
1149 		else if (itv->std & V4L2_STD_NTSC)
1150 			itv->std = V4L2_STD_NTSC_M;
1151 		else if (itv->std & V4L2_STD_SECAM)
1152 			itv->std = V4L2_STD_SECAM_L;
1153 		itv->options.tuner = itv->card->tuners[0].tuner;
1154 	}
1155 	if (itv->options.radio == -1)
1156 		itv->options.radio = (itv->card->radio_input.audio_type != 0);
1157 
1158 	/* The card is now fully identified, continue with card-specific
1159 	   initialization. */
1160 	ivtv_init_struct2(itv);
1161 
1162 	ivtv_load_and_init_modules(itv);
1163 
1164 	if (itv->std & V4L2_STD_525_60) {
1165 		itv->is_60hz = 1;
1166 		itv->is_out_60hz = 1;
1167 	} else {
1168 		itv->is_50hz = 1;
1169 		itv->is_out_50hz = 1;
1170 	}
1171 
1172 	itv->yuv_info.osd_full_w = 720;
1173 	itv->yuv_info.osd_full_h = itv->is_out_50hz ? 576 : 480;
1174 	itv->yuv_info.v4l2_src_w = itv->yuv_info.osd_full_w;
1175 	itv->yuv_info.v4l2_src_h = itv->yuv_info.osd_full_h;
1176 
1177 	cx2341x_handler_set_50hz(&itv->cxhdl, itv->is_50hz);
1178 
1179 	itv->stream_buf_size[IVTV_ENC_STREAM_TYPE_MPG] = 0x08000;
1180 	itv->stream_buf_size[IVTV_ENC_STREAM_TYPE_PCM] = 0x01200;
1181 	itv->stream_buf_size[IVTV_DEC_STREAM_TYPE_MPG] = 0x10000;
1182 	itv->stream_buf_size[IVTV_DEC_STREAM_TYPE_YUV] = 0x10000;
1183 	itv->stream_buf_size[IVTV_ENC_STREAM_TYPE_YUV] = 0x08000;
1184 
1185 	/* Setup VBI Raw Size. Should be big enough to hold PAL.
1186 	   It is possible to switch between PAL and NTSC, so we need to
1187 	   take the largest size here. */
1188 	/* 1456 is multiple of 16, real size = 1444 */
1189 	itv->vbi.raw_size = 1456;
1190 	/* We use a buffer size of 1/2 of the total size needed for a
1191 	   frame. This is actually very useful, since we now receive
1192 	   a field at a time and that makes 'compressing' the raw data
1193 	   down to size by stripping off the SAV codes a lot easier.
1194 	   Note: having two different buffer sizes prevents standard
1195 	   switching on the fly. We need to find a better solution... */
1196 	vbi_buf_size = itv->vbi.raw_size * (itv->is_60hz ? 24 : 36) / 2;
1197 	itv->stream_buf_size[IVTV_ENC_STREAM_TYPE_VBI] = vbi_buf_size;
1198 	itv->stream_buf_size[IVTV_DEC_STREAM_TYPE_VBI] = sizeof(struct v4l2_sliced_vbi_data) * 36;
1199 
1200 	if (itv->options.radio > 0)
1201 		itv->v4l2_cap |= V4L2_CAP_RADIO;
1202 
1203 	if (itv->options.tuner > -1) {
1204 		struct tuner_setup setup;
1205 
1206 		setup.addr = ADDR_UNSET;
1207 		setup.type = itv->options.tuner;
1208 		setup.mode_mask = T_ANALOG_TV;  /* matches TV tuners */
1209 		if (itv->options.radio > 0)
1210 			setup.mode_mask |= T_RADIO;
1211 		setup.tuner_callback = (setup.type == TUNER_XC2028) ?
1212 			ivtv_reset_tuner_gpio : NULL;
1213 		ivtv_call_all(itv, tuner, s_type_addr, &setup);
1214 		if (setup.type == TUNER_XC2028) {
1215 			static struct xc2028_ctrl ctrl = {
1216 				.fname = XC2028_DEFAULT_FIRMWARE,
1217 				.max_len = 64,
1218 			};
1219 			struct v4l2_priv_tun_config cfg = {
1220 				.tuner = itv->options.tuner,
1221 				.priv = &ctrl,
1222 			};
1223 			ivtv_call_all(itv, tuner, s_config, &cfg);
1224 		}
1225 	}
1226 
1227 	/* The tuner is fixed to the standard. The other inputs (e.g. S-Video)
1228 	   are not. */
1229 	itv->tuner_std = itv->std;
1230 
1231 	if (itv->v4l2_cap & V4L2_CAP_VIDEO_OUTPUT) {
1232 		struct v4l2_ctrl_handler *hdl = itv->v4l2_dev.ctrl_handler;
1233 
1234 		itv->ctrl_pts = v4l2_ctrl_new_std(hdl, &ivtv_hdl_out_ops,
1235 				V4L2_CID_MPEG_VIDEO_DEC_PTS, 0, 0, 0, 0);
1236 		itv->ctrl_frame = v4l2_ctrl_new_std(hdl, &ivtv_hdl_out_ops,
1237 				V4L2_CID_MPEG_VIDEO_DEC_FRAME, 0, 0, 0, 0);
1238 		/* Note: V4L2_MPEG_AUDIO_DEC_PLAYBACK_AUTO is not supported,
1239 		   mask that menu item. */
1240 		itv->ctrl_audio_playback =
1241 			v4l2_ctrl_new_std_menu(hdl, &ivtv_hdl_out_ops,
1242 				V4L2_CID_MPEG_AUDIO_DEC_PLAYBACK,
1243 				V4L2_MPEG_AUDIO_DEC_PLAYBACK_SWAPPED_STEREO,
1244 				1 << V4L2_MPEG_AUDIO_DEC_PLAYBACK_AUTO,
1245 				V4L2_MPEG_AUDIO_DEC_PLAYBACK_STEREO);
1246 		itv->ctrl_audio_multilingual_playback =
1247 			v4l2_ctrl_new_std_menu(hdl, &ivtv_hdl_out_ops,
1248 				V4L2_CID_MPEG_AUDIO_DEC_MULTILINGUAL_PLAYBACK,
1249 				V4L2_MPEG_AUDIO_DEC_PLAYBACK_SWAPPED_STEREO,
1250 				1 << V4L2_MPEG_AUDIO_DEC_PLAYBACK_AUTO,
1251 				V4L2_MPEG_AUDIO_DEC_PLAYBACK_LEFT);
1252 		if (hdl->error) {
1253 			retval = hdl->error;
1254 			goto free_i2c;
1255 		}
1256 		v4l2_ctrl_cluster(2, &itv->ctrl_pts);
1257 		v4l2_ctrl_cluster(2, &itv->ctrl_audio_playback);
1258 		ivtv_call_all(itv, video, s_std_output, itv->std);
1259 		/* Turn off the output signal. The mpeg decoder is not yet
1260 		   active so without this you would get a green image until the
1261 		   mpeg decoder becomes active. */
1262 		ivtv_call_hw(itv, IVTV_HW_SAA7127, video, s_stream, 0);
1263 	}
1264 
1265 	/* clear interrupt mask, effectively disabling interrupts */
1266 	ivtv_set_irq_mask(itv, 0xffffffff);
1267 
1268 	/* Register IRQ */
1269 	retval = request_irq(itv->pdev->irq, ivtv_irq_handler,
1270 	     IRQF_SHARED | IRQF_DISABLED, itv->v4l2_dev.name, (void *)itv);
1271 	if (retval) {
1272 		IVTV_ERR("Failed to register irq %d\n", retval);
1273 		goto free_i2c;
1274 	}
1275 
1276 	retval = ivtv_streams_setup(itv);
1277 	if (retval) {
1278 		IVTV_ERR("Error %d setting up streams\n", retval);
1279 		goto free_irq;
1280 	}
1281 	retval = ivtv_streams_register(itv);
1282 	if (retval) {
1283 		IVTV_ERR("Error %d registering devices\n", retval);
1284 		goto free_streams;
1285 	}
1286 	IVTV_INFO("Initialized card: %s\n", itv->card_name);
1287 
1288 	/* Load ivtv submodules (ivtv-alsa) */
1289 	request_modules(itv);
1290 	return 0;
1291 
1292 free_streams:
1293 	ivtv_streams_cleanup(itv, 1);
1294 free_irq:
1295 	free_irq(itv->pdev->irq, (void *)itv);
1296 free_i2c:
1297 	v4l2_ctrl_handler_free(&itv->cxhdl.hdl);
1298 	exit_ivtv_i2c(itv);
1299 free_io:
1300 	ivtv_iounmap(itv);
1301 free_mem:
1302 	release_mem_region(itv->base_addr, IVTV_ENCODER_SIZE);
1303 	release_mem_region(itv->base_addr + IVTV_REG_OFFSET, IVTV_REG_SIZE);
1304 	if (itv->has_cx23415)
1305 		release_mem_region(itv->base_addr + IVTV_DECODER_OFFSET, IVTV_DECODER_SIZE);
1306 free_worker:
1307 	kthread_stop(itv->irq_worker_task);
1308 err:
1309 	if (retval == 0)
1310 		retval = -ENODEV;
1311 	IVTV_ERR("Error %d on initialization\n", retval);
1312 
1313 	v4l2_device_unregister(&itv->v4l2_dev);
1314 	kfree(itv);
1315 	return retval;
1316 }
